Explaining the SR22 Insurance Requirement



When you find out you need SR22 insurance, you might be feeling confused. While it may sound like a unique type of insurance policy, an SR22 is actually a form submitted to the DMV needed by the state in certain circumstances. Let’s clarify what SR22 insurance is, who needs it, how it works, and why choosing a trusted provider is essential.

What Is SR22 Insurance?

Despite the name, SR22 insurance is not a standalone insurance product. It’s a certificate that your insurer files with the state to prove that you have the mandatory insurance by law. You can think of it as a guarantee from your insurer that you’re financially responsible while driving.

Who Needs SR22 Insurance?

You might be required to carry an SR22 if you’ve been involved in specific traffic-related offenses, such as:

• Driving under the influence
• Dangerous driving behavior
• Operating a vehicle without insurance
• Numerous infractions
• Driver’s license issues

The SR22 requirement is often included in the reinstatement process for your driver's license after such infractions.

How Long Is SR22 Insurance Required?

The duration you need to maintain SR22 coverage can differ by location, but in most cases, it’s required for three years. It’s important to keep the policy active during this time. If it lapses, your insurer must notify the state, which could cause another license suspension.

SR22 Insurance Pricing

The cost of filing an SR22 form is usually affordable—typically between $15 and $50. However, your coverage costs may go up depending on your driving history and the reason for the SR22. Drivers with violations often face higher rates, so it’s smart to compare quotes from multiple providers.

How to Get SR22 Insurance

Follow these steps to obtain SR22 insurance:

1. Get in touch with your insurance provider and inform them you need an SR22.
2. Adjust or begin your auto insurance policy to meet state legal requirements.
3. Your insurer will submit the certificate with the state.
4. You’ll receive confirmation once the state has accepted the filing.

Some companies don’t provide SR22 filings, so it’s recommended to work with one that can handle the process.
